Summary
The student-faculty ratio at Monmouth College is 14:1, and the school has 57.0 percent of its classes with fewer than 20 students. The most popular majors at Monmouth College include: Business, Management, Marketing, and Related Support Services; Education; Communication, Journalism, and Related Programs; History; and Visual and Performing Arts. The average freshman retention rate, an indicator of student satisfaction, is 74.8 percent.

Academic Programs & Offerings
| Degrees offered | Bachelor's | ||||||||||||
| Combined-degree programs | 3/2 Cooperative agreement with University of Southern California (USC) in engineering; 3/2 program with Washington University (St. Louis): engineering; Cooperative agreement with Creighton University: physics BA + masters in atmospheric science; Cooperative agreement with Rush University (Chicago): medical technician; Cooperative agreement with Rush University (Chicago): nursing; Cooperative agreement with Rush University (Chicago): occupational therapy; Cooperative program with Case Western Reserve University: engineering (3/2 Binary Program) | ||||||||||||
